Bathalang Population - Solan, Himachal Pradesh

Bathalang is a small village located in Arki Tehsil of Solan district, Himachal Pradesh with total 34 families residing. The Bathalang village has population of 179 of which 98 are males while 81 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bathalang village population of children with age 0-6 is 20 which makes up 11.17 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bathalang village is 827 which is lower than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Bathalang as per census is 1222, higher than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Bathalang village has higher liter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Bathalang village was 83.02 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Bathalang Male literacy stands at 87.64 % while female literacy rate was 77.14 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Bathalang village of Solan district.

Work Profile

In Bathalang village out of total population, 147 were engaged in work activities. 70.07 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 29.93 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 147 workers engaged in Main Work, 50 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
